
Squirrel (programming language)
Open SourceSquirrel is a high-level, imperative and object-oriented programming language designed for embedding in applications.
Discover Windows Softwares to Scripting language.
Ideal for writing scripts to automate tasks and automate system administration.
Squirrel is a high-level, imperative and object-oriented programming language designed for embedding in applications.
Adventure Game Studio (AGS) is a powerful and free open-source development system designed specifically for creating point-and-click adventure games. It provides a complete suite of tools for artists, designers, and programmers to bring their interactive stories to life, enabling the creation of classic-style adventure games with modern capabilities.
LiveScript is a functional programming language that compiles directly to JavaScript, offering a more expressive syntax and advanced features like pattern matching and macros for streamlined web development.
F# is an open-source, cross-platform, functional-first programming language designed for conciseness and correctness. It integrates seamlessly with the .NET ecosystem, making it ideal for data science, web development, and more.
Denemo is a robust free software graphical user interface (GUI) designed for efficient music notation, primarily acting as a front-end for the powerful GNU LilyPond music engraver. It allows musicians and composers to create high-quality musical scores.
JRuby is a robust implementation of the Ruby programming language built on the Java Virtual Machine (JVM). It provides seamless interoperability between Ruby and Java, allowing developers to leverage the strengths of both ecosystems.
Second Life is a vast online virtual world where users, represented by customizable avatars, can explore, interact, create content, and engage in a simulated economy. It's a platform for social networking, creative expression, and diverse experiences.
Apache Groovy is a powerful, optionally typed and dynamic language for the Java platform. It seamlessly integrates with existing Java code and libraries, making it a versatile tool for scripting, application development, testing, and automation.
Twine is a powerful, open-source tool designed for creating interactive, non-linear stories, games, and hypertext narratives. It empowers writers, game developers, and creatives to construct complex branching narratives without needing programming knowledge.
OpenSCAD is a powerful, free software for creating solid 3D CAD objects using a descriptive programming language. It's not an interactive modeller but focuses on constructive solid geometry (CSG) and extrusion of 2D outlines.
Scala is a powerful, general-purpose programming language designed to combine the best features of object-oriented and functional programming paradigms.
Sikuli is an open-source tool and scripting language designed for automating graphical user interfaces (GUIs) using image recognition. It allows users to interact with screen elements based on their appearance, making it ideal for automating tasks, testing applications, and performing workflow automation without relying on traditional API interfaces.
Perl is a highly-capable, feature-rich programming language with over 30 years of development. Widely used for text processing, web development, and systems administration, it is known for its power and flexibility.
Lua is a powerful, fast, and lightweight scripting language designed for embedding in applications. It's known for its simplicity, portability, and efficiency, making it ideal for a wide range of uses from embedded systems to game development and configuration.
AutoIt v3 is a free, easy-to-use automation tool designed for Windows. It's a BASIC-like scripting language that allows users to automate Windows GUI interactions and perform general scripting tasks, making repetitive operations simple and efficient.
Ruby is a dynamic, open-source programming language known for its elegant syntax and focus on developer productivity. It's widely used for web development, scripting, and rapid prototyping.
PHP is a versatile, open-source scripting language widely used for web development. It excels at creating dynamic web content, interacting with databases, and integrating seamlessly with HTML.
JavaScript is a versatile, high-level programming language primarily used for creating dynamic and interactive web content. It runs directly in web browsers and is a fundamental technology alongside HTML and CSS.
iMacros is a versatile web browser extension designed for automating repetitive tasks on the web. It captures user interactions like clicks and form entries, converting them into scripts (macros) that can be replayed. This makes it ideal for web testing, form filling, data extraction, and various workflow automations across different browsers.
Python is a versatile, high-level programming language renowned for its readability and simplicity. It supports multiple programming paradigms, including object-oriented, imperative, and functional programming styles. It boasts a large and active community, extensive libraries, and is widely used for web development, data science, artificial intelligence, and scripting.